09.05.2026 - 08:39:37 | ad-hoc-news.desecunet Security Networks has drawn investor attention after releasing its latest quarterly results, which show continued growth in revenue and earnings driven by demand for secure IT infrastructure in public administration, defense and critical sectors. The German cybersecurity specialist reported higher sales and improved profitability compared to the prior year, underscoring the ongoing relevance of its secure communication and identity management solutions in an environment of rising cyber threats and digitalization of government services.
According to the company’s latest quarterly report, secunet recorded revenue growth in the mid?single?digit percentage range year?on?year, with particular strength in its core business areas such as secure communications, identity and access management, and secure infrastructure for public authorities. The firm also noted an increase in order intake, indicating a healthy pipeline of projects in the public sector and critical infrastructure. These developments come amid broader European and German efforts to strengthen cybersecurity in government networks and critical systems, which secunet positions itself to benefit from through its long?standing relationships with federal and state authorities.

secunet Security Networks: core business model
secunet Security Networks operates as a specialist provider of secure IT solutions, focusing on the design, implementation and operation of highly secure communication and information systems. The company’s business model centers on long?term projects and framework agreements with public authorities, defense organizations and operators of critical infrastructure, where data protection, confidentiality and resilience are paramount. secunet develops and integrates secure networks, encryption solutions, identity management platforms and secure endpoints, often tailored to specific regulatory and security requirements.
A key element of secunet’s strategy is its role as a trusted partner to government agencies, including federal ministries, state authorities and defense institutions. The company frequently participates in large?scale digitalization programs that require secure data exchange, such as e?government platforms, secure telemedicine networks and secure communication systems for emergency services. By combining proprietary software, certified hardware and consulting services, secunet aims to deliver end?to?end security architectures that meet stringent national and European standards.
secunet also emphasizes recurring revenue streams through maintenance, support and managed services, which help stabilize cash flows alongside project?based business. The company’s focus on regulated and mission?critical environments reduces exposure to purely consumer?oriented IT cycles, but also makes it sensitive to public?sector budget cycles and procurement timelines.
Main revenue and product drivers for secunet Security Networks
secunet’s revenue is primarily driven by three pillars: secure communications, identity and access management, and secure infrastructure solutions. Within secure communications, the company supplies encrypted voice and data networks, secure messaging platforms and secure video conferencing systems for government and defense customers. These solutions are often deployed under long?term framework agreements, providing visibility into future project volumes.
Identity and access management represents another growth area, as public authorities and critical infrastructure operators increasingly adopt centralized identity platforms to control access to sensitive systems and data. secunet’s offerings in this segment include digital identity solutions, multi?factor authentication and secure citizen services, which support digital government initiatives and online identity verification. The company also participates in national digital identity programs, where it provides technical components and integration services.
Secure infrastructure projects, such as the setup of protected data centers, secure cloud environments and resilient network backbones, contribute a significant share of revenue. These projects are typically large, multi?year engagements that involve close collaboration with public?sector clients and other technology partners. The combination of project work and ongoing service contracts helps secunet balance one?off project spikes with more predictable service income.
